Types of Personal Injury Compensation

You could be eligible for compensation if you sustained an injury due to the negligence or wrongdoing of a third person. Speak with an attorney who specializes in personal injury near you to find out more about the damages you could receive.

In personal injury cases there are two kinds of damages that may occur: non-economic and economic. This article will go over these categories and explain how they can impact the amount of compensation you are entitled to receive.

Economic Damages

When a person is injured in an accident, they may be entitled to compensation for their losses. These can include medical expenses along with lost wages and property damage.

Most of the time, these types of damage can be very costly especially in the event of serious injuries. Since they require intensive medical treatment. After recovering, patients may require prescription medication or mobility equipment.

These expenses can quickly mount up This is why it is essential to keep receipts. These receipts can help you determine the true value of your losses as well as increase your compensation.

In personal injury cases, lost wages and future income are typical forms of economic damage. This is because victims may be out of work for weeks, months, and even years after an accident. In these situations the victim must receive the amount they could have earned if they were able to work.


If a person is disabled or the death of a family member occurs due to an accident, the victim may be eligible to receive damages for life care services. These include nursing, home health, and physical therapy.

Many people require assistance with the same tasks that they did prior to their accident. These may include household chores, driving a vehicle as well as taking care of the outdoors, and taking care of an individual in the family who is dependent.

In these cases an attorney might be able to provide receipts, bills as well as other evidence of the cost of these items. They can also engage experts to testify regarding the worth of these damages.

The value of these damages could vary in a wide range depending on the circumstances of the accident and the victim's specific needs. In general, juries look at a variety of factors when determining an award for economic damages.
